Compare all specifications:
1955 Studebaker President State | 2007 Audi A3 | |
Make | Studebaker | Audi |
Model | President State | A3 |
Year Released | 1955 | 2007 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 4244 cc | 1968 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 8 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 2 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 174 HP | 139 HP |
Engine RPM | 4500 RPM | 4000 RPM |
Torque | 353 Nm | 320 Nm |
Engine Bore Size | 90.5 mm | 81 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 82.6 mm | 95.5 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 8.5:1 | 18.0:1 |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Diesel |
Drive Type | Rear | Front |
Vehicle Weight | 1550 kg | 1450 kg |
Vehicle Length | 5250 mm | 4290 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1770 mm | 1770 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1530 mm | 1430 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 3070 mm | 2580 mm |
